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
342 09122 601070
30580510658 5046915057 0490889
30580510658 5046915057 0490889
789 678 48883387920 32261476032
All about undefined
Interested in learning more?
30580510658 5046915057 0490889
789 678 48883387920 32261476032
See more
966 12339709
5597 26079 7168093 811 917268179
See more
1311 00232483 824
8319147 96 59068137
See more